|  | 14 | /* | 
|  | 15 | * The struct used to pass data via the following ioctl. Similar to the | 
| David Brownell | ab6a2d7 | 2007-05-08 00:33:30 -0700 | [diff] [blame] | 16 | * struct tm in <time.h>, but it needs to be here so that the kernel | 
| Linus Torvalds | 1da177e | 2005-04-16 15:20:36 -0700 | [diff] [blame] | 17 | * source is self contained, allowing cross-compiles, etc. etc. | 
|  | 18 | */ | 
|  | 19 |  | 
|  | 20 | struct rtc_time { | 
|  | 21 | int tm_sec; | 
|  | 22 | int tm_min; | 
|  | 23 | int tm_hour; | 
|  | 24 | int tm_mday; | 
|  | 25 | int tm_mon; | 
|  | 26 | int tm_year; | 
|  | 27 | int tm_wday; | 
|  | 28 | int tm_yday; | 
|  | 29 | int tm_isdst; | 
|  | 30 | }; |

|  | 42 | /* | 
|  | 43 | * Data structure to control PLL correction some better RTC feature | 
|  | 44 | * pll_value is used to get or set current value of correction, | 
|  | 45 | * the rest of the struct is used to query HW capabilities. | 
|  | 46 | * This is modeled after the RTC used in Q40/Q60 computers but | 
|  | 47 | * should be sufficiently flexible for other devices | 
|  | 48 | * | 
|  | 49 | * +ve pll_value means clock will run faster by | 
|  | 50 | *   pll_value*pll_posmult/pll_clock | 
|  | 51 | * -ve pll_value means clock will run slower by | 
|  | 52 | *   pll_value*pll_negmult/pll_clock | 
| David Brownell | ab6a2d7 | 2007-05-08 00:33:30 -0700 | [diff] [blame] | 53 | */ | 
| Linus Torvalds | 1da177e | 2005-04-16 15:20:36 -0700 | [diff] [blame] | 54 |  | 
|  | 55 | struct rtc_pll_info { | 
|  | 56 | int pll_ctrl;       /* placeholder for fancier control */ | 
|  | 57 | int pll_value;      /* get/set correction value */ | 
|  | 58 | int pll_max;        /* max +ve (faster) adjustment value */ | 
|  | 59 | int pll_min;        /* max -ve (slower) adjustment value */ | 
|  | 60 | int pll_posmult;    /* factor for +ve correction */ | 
|  | 61 | int pll_negmult;    /* factor for -ve correction */ | 
|  | 62 | long pll_clock;     /* base PLL frequency */ | 
|  | 63 | }; |

| David Brownell | 5ad31a5 | 2008-07-23 21:30:33 -0700 | [diff] [blame] | 119 | /* | 
|  | 120 | * For these RTC methods the device parameter is the physical device | 
|  | 121 | * on whatever bus holds the hardware (I2C, Platform, SPI, etc), which | 
|  | 122 | * was passed to rtc_device_register().  Its driver_data normally holds | 
|  | 123 | * device state, including the rtc_device pointer for the RTC. | 
|  | 124 | * | 
|  | 125 | * Most of these methods are called with rtc_device.ops_lock held, | 
|  | 126 | * through the rtc_*(struct rtc_device *, ...) calls. | 
|  | 127 | * | 
|  | 128 | * The (current) exceptions are mostly filesystem hooks: | 
|  | 129 | *   - the proc() hook for procfs | 
|  | 130 | *   - non-ioctl() chardev hooks:  open(), release(), read_callback() | 
|  | 131 | *   - periodic irq calls:  irq_set_state(), irq_set_freq() | 
|  | 132 | * | 
|  | 133 | * REVISIT those periodic irq calls *do* have ops_lock when they're | 
|  | 134 | * issued through ioctl() ... | 
|  | 135 | */ | 
| Alessandro Zummo | 0c86edc | 2006-03-27 01:16:37 -0800 | [diff] [blame] | 136 | struct rtc_class_ops { | 
|  | 137 | int (*open)(struct device *); | 
|  | 138 | void (*release)(struct device *); | 
|  | 139 | int (*ioctl)(struct device *, unsigned int, unsigned long); | 
|  | 140 | int (*read_time)(struct device *, struct rtc_time *); | 
|  | 141 | int (*set_time)(struct device *, struct rtc_time *); | 
|  | 142 | int (*read_alarm)(struct device *, struct rtc_wkalrm *); | 
|  | 143 | int (*set_alarm)(struct device *, struct rtc_wkalrm *); | 
|  | 144 | int (*proc)(struct device *, struct seq_file *); | 
|  | 145 | int (*set_mmss)(struct device *, unsigned long secs); | 
|  | 146 | int (*irq_set_state)(struct device *, int enabled); | 
|  | 147 | int (*irq_set_freq)(struct device *, int freq); | 
|  | 148 | int (*read_callback)(struct device *, int data); | 
| Alessandro Zummo | 099e657 | 2009-01-04 12:00:54 -0800 | [diff] [blame] | 149 | int (*alarm_irq_enable)(struct device *, unsigned int enabled); | 
|  | 150 | int (*update_irq_enable)(struct device *, unsigned int enabled); | 
| Alessandro Zummo | 0c86edc | 2006-03-27 01:16:37 -0800 | [diff] [blame] | 151 | }; |
